Vehicle to Building Technology Investment to Total Nearly $280 Million through 2020, Forecasts Pike Research
The concept of making the energy stored in plug-in electric vehicle (PEV) batteries available to commercial buildings and residences with intelligent building energy management systems, known as vehicle-to-building (V2B) technology, has been studied since the 1990s. Today, these approaches have the potential to provide storage capacity to benefit the vehicle owner and the building owner, by offsetting some of the higher cost of PEVs, by lowering the energy costs of the building, and by providing reliable emergency backup services. Corporate sustainability does improve financial stability
‘Doing good’ can lead to ‘doing well’ for companies that implement corporate sustainability, according to a new study by Polish researchers. Eighty-five American companies that met corporate sustainability criteria proved to have better returns and greater stability in stock price than average, and better growth rates than their less sustainable counterparts. In recent years, corporate sustainability has become something of a buzzword.
